It’s gotten 300,000 views in one week. The teaser video for ‘Only One’, JYJ’s Incheon Asiad song, has been met with an explosive response.
On the 3rd, the Incheon Asian Games committee uploaded the video on their official YouTube channel (http://www.youtube.com/Incheon2014) and it garnered over 300,000 viewers in one week. Fans from all over the world, not only Korea and Asia, have shown their interest in the song with over 1,600 comments made in various languages such as English, Korea, Japanese and Chinese.
JYJ, who are at the center of Asia’s Hallyu Wave, were chosen to be the honorary ambassadors of the Incheon Asian Games in February. They have been working since the early months of this year on an Incheon Asiad song and music video that the four billion people of Asia can enjoy together.
The teaser video, which is around 38 seconds long, shows the members of JYJ entering the main Asiad stadium and cheering for their Incheon Asian Games. Shots of the three members recording the song, practicing the choreography and shooting the music video have Hallyu fans and sports fans alike excited to see what comes next.
The full audio and music video of ‘Only One’ will be released all across Asia on the 16th, exactly one year till the games begin. Afterwards, JYJ will be promoting the Incheon Asian Games on a ‘road show’ across Asia in countries such as China and Vietnam.

‘HEROSE’, the fanclub of JYJ’s Kim Jaejoong, has donated 10 million Won to the Beautiful Foundation.
The fanclub revealed on the 10th that they collected a total of 10 million Won from selling glowsticks at Kim Jaejoong’s mini concerts, which began in Korea in January and ended in Japan in June, and donated the revenue to the ‘Kim Jaejoong Boomerang Scholarship’ of the Beautiful Foundation.
The Beautiful Foundation’s ‘Kim Jaejoong Boomerang Scholarship’ was created by ‘HEROSE’ with a 15 million Won donation in December of 2011 and has been used to pay for school fees for high school students. The scholarship is being funded by Kim Jaejoong’s fans, with his Japanese fanclub recently donating 11 million Won in May.

Korean dramas have finally landed in Greece, the wastelands of the Hallyu Wave.
According to the Greek embassy, MBC’s ‘I Miss You’, which features Park Yoochun as the leading role, began airing on ‘TV100′ on the 4th.
TV100 has ‘I Miss You’ scheduled at 10p.m. on Wednesdays and Fridays, a prime time TV slot, and also airs the episodes for a second time on Sundays at 2p.m. TV100 airs in Thessaloniki, the second largest city of Greece, and attracts 2 million viewers in the central northern districts of Greece.
A representative of the region stated, “Thessaloniki has a lot of JYJ fans, so we believe that Park Yoochun’s drama will be very popular there.”
Kim Byung Yeon of the Korean Embassy of Greece stated, “The hard work and cooperation of Greek broadcasting companies, Korean broadcasting companies, Greece-based Korean companies and the local fanclub since last year have finally seen the fruits of their labor.”
A representative explained, “The drama ‘I Miss You’ has already been exported to various parts of Asia, thanks to the help of the global reach of Park Yoochun’s fandom, and is currently gearing towards a global release in Europe and the US with a dubbed version of the production.”
Meanwhile, Park Yoochun is currently preparing for his movie ‘Sea Fog’, which will begin filming in the second half of this year.

Hallyu group TVXQ have taken the number one spot on the Oricon Charts in just two days since releasing their latest Japanese single.
According to the Oricon Charts, TVXQ’s 38th single ‘SCREAM’, which was released on the 4th, sold an additional 56,316 copies and topped the daily singles charts.
TVXQ entered the charts in second place after losing to ‘Melon Juice’ by HKT48, the sister group of AKB48, but topped the charts on the second day by selling more than three times as much as HKT48. TVXQ have sold a total of 113,386 copies in two days and have proven yet again just how popular they are in Japan.
As the first song in three months since their June-released single ‘Ocean’, ‘SCREAM’ has already been chosen as the OST of ‘Sadako 3D 2′, and as the theme song of various programs such as ‘Hiruobi’ and ‘MUSIC BB’.
TVXQ will be releasing their ‘TVXQ LIVE TOUR 2013 ~TIME~’ live recording DVD on the 23rd of October.
